The National Association of Home Builders (NAHB) and the National Kitchen & Bath Association (NKBA) have announced an agreement to co-locate the International Builders' Show (IBS) and the Kitchen & Bath Industry Show (KBIS) in Las Vegas beginning in February 2014.
The new event will be held Feb. 4-6, 2014, at the Las Vegas Convention Center; organizers are dubbing it Design and Construction Week. The two events will remain separate shows held simultaneously.
Kitchen and bath brands that have participated in both shows can choose to exhibit in the KBIS or IBS hall, and one pass will provide access to both exhibits. Future show dates are Jan. 20-22, 2015, and Jan. 19-21, 2016.
The event is expected to draw more than 75,000 specifiers, builders, dealers and suppliers and 2,000 exhibiting brands, based on recent trends for both shows.
